CROSSROADS NURSING & REHABILITATION

HEARNE, TX · Medicare-certified · 80 beds

In good standing
For-profitChain member
3 of 5 overall

CROSSROADS NURSING & REHABILITATION in Hearne, TX has an overall 3-star rating, with strong quality measures (5 stars) but very poor staffing (1 star) and reported nurse staffing below the federal benchmark (2.97 vs 4.1 hours/resident/day). Its health inspection rating is 3 stars, it had $0 in fines in the last 24 months, and recent inspection citations included activities, medication errors, and food safety.

What the inspectors found

The home failed to provide activities that met all residents’ needs. Cited December 2025 — limited pattern,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 679 — 42 CFR §483.24 — S/S: E

The nursing home failed to keep medication mistakes below the allowed level. Cited December 2025 — limited pattern,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 759 — 42 CFR §483.45(f)(1) — S/S: E

The home failed to make sure food was safely sourced, stored, prepared, and served according to professional standards. Cited December 2025 — limited pattern,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 812 — 42 CFR §483.60(i) — S/S: E

The nursing home failed to provide and carry out an infection prevention and control program to help keep residents from getting or spreading infections. Cited December 2025 — limited pattern,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 880 — 42 CFR §483.80(a) — S/S: E

The nursing home failed to provide proper pressure ulcer care and failed to prevent new pressure sores from developing. Cited May 2024 — limited pattern, potential for harm.
